LynuxWorks Announces Membership in Future Airborne Capability Environment (FACET) Consortium

SAN JOSE, CA–March 19, 2012LynuxWorks, Inc., a world leader in the embedded software market, today announced its membership in the Future Airborne Capability Environment (FACE™) Consortium, managed by The Open Group, to provide a common airborne computing environment for the Navy and other military branches. The FACE Consortium is an industry-government collaboration consisting of 39 members, including the U.S. Navy Air Combat Electronics Program Office, the U.S. Army Aviation and Missile Research and Engineering Center, and several leading industry defense contractors and avionics suppliers. 

The new FACE™ Technical Standard defines a reference architecture for creating a common operating environment to support applications across multiple Department of Defense avionics systems. The standard is designed to enhance the U.S. military aviation community’s ability to address issues of limited software reuse and accelerate and enhance warfighter capabilities, as well as enabling the community to take advantage of new technologies more rapidly and affordably.

About The Open Group FACE™ Consortium

A managed consortium hosted by The Open Group, The Future Airborne Capability Environment (FACE™) Consortium is an aviation-focused professional group made up of industry suppliers, customers and users. The Consortium is creating a technologically appropriate open FACE reference architecture, standards and business model that will result in:

  •        Standardized approaches for using open standards within avionics systems
  •        Lower implementation costs of FACE systems
  •        Standards that support a robust architecture and enable quality software development
  •        The use of standard interfaces that will lead to reuse of capabilities
  •        Defined interoperability within FACE systems and components
  •        Portability of applications across multiple FACE systems and vendors
  •        Procurement of FACE conformant products
  •        More capabilities reaching the Warfighter faster
  •        Innovation and competition within the avionics industry

The FACE Consortium provides a vendor-neutral forum for industry and the U.S. government to work together to develop and consolidate the open standards, best practices, guidance documents and business models necessary to achieve these results.
